Output 06274029fd4b8240183a6c48756039a18689660e86d0b88c6cef2b6cd42fafbc:0

value
76100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c14c20b37d16e792d704a893784dd8bff33af156 OP_EQUAL
address
3KK5Y1psCcgEDfZPBZfdzCpsgmayfDEepw
transaction
06274029fd4b8240183a6c48756039a18689660e86d0b88c6cef2b6cd42fafbc
confirmations
145005
spent
true